    Four U.S. Soldiers Found Dead After Training Exercise Near
    Belarusian Border

    The soldiers are believed to have gotten trapped in their
    vehicle after it became submerged in water.

    The U.S. military said that the soldiers were riding in a
    M88 Hercules armored recovery vehicle, which is a giant
    armored tow truck designed to pull damaged tanks off the
    battlefield, when they went missing.

    The vehicle was “discovered submerged in a body of water
    in a training area after a search by U.S. Army, Lithuanian
    Armed Forces and other Lithuanian authorities,” the statement
    said. “Recovery efforts are underway by U.S. Army and Lithuanian
    Armed Forces and civilian agencies.”
